I have a C-more EA1-S3ML that I want to connect to a USB port for programming. I have and use a GoldX GXMU-1201 USB to 9pin serial adapter I use for programming the Click PLC. Is there a cable I can make up for this connection. The manual and the website refer to a different USB to Serial adapter and a serial cable with modular connectors on both ends. I need a 9pin to rj12.

In normal operation the EA1 gets its power through the communication cable from the PLC. When you program the CMore Micro it obviously is not connected to the PLC. Therefore the programming cable must provide its power. Thus there is the special USB adapter for this unit which not only feeds data but also power to the panel. Make sure to label it for use ONLY in programming the CMore Micro.
I haven't seen a serial port to CMore Micro programming cable.

The EA-MG-PGM-CBL will work with both the Cmore Micro and the Click PLC without issues. I have also used it on the DL 05.
